Located in the northern part of Yunlin County, Taiwan Province of China, Dabi Township is a typical agricultural township, famous throughout Taiwan for its production of rice, sauerkraut and pickles. The terrain of the township is flat, with a total area of about 44.9973 square kilometers and a population of about 18,000 people. Dabi Township is known as the "hometown of sauerkraut," and its production of sauerkraut accounts for more than 80% of all sauerkraut produced in Taiwan. The annual Sauerkraut Culture Festival has become a local specialty.
Dabi Township is rich in traditional culture, with temples such as the Sanshan King's Temple and the Hall of the North Pole in full bloom. The township has a number of well-preserved large ponds (Bei Tongs), such as Dabi Tong and Shangyi Bei, which serve both irrigation and ecological functions. These water landscapes and rural scenery form a unique rural landscape, attracting many tourists to experience the local flavor and taste local agricultural products.
Tianjin and Hebei, China are located in the North China Plain and have significant location advantages. Tianjin, as a municipality directly under the central government, is the core area of international shipping and advanced manufacturing base in northern China, with the geographical endowment of "the key point of the river and the sea", and has been a window for the fusion of Chinese and Western cultures since modern times, famous for its historical features and modern cityscape such as the hometown of Jinmen and the five avenues of style streets. Surrounding Beijing and Tianjin, Hebei is an important part of the Beijing-Tianjin-Hebei world-class city cluster, with rich historical and cultural resources, such as the Chengde Summer Resort and the Great Wall at Shanhaiguan, etc. Meanwhile, it is also a large agricultural province and a heavy industrial base, and it is actively undertaking the dissolution of Beijing's non-capital functions and accelerating the transformation and upgrading of industries, and the synergistic development between the two cities is pushing the regional economy to a new height.
